Output 5670224cfa14b554a2428a3880b21e49fe3452935a0aa4611dbb03de00026c88:2

value
2087842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be90a23d9d60c7bd0c021c320463b95c76d8aa8e OP_EQUAL
address
3K4daKZaShGDSi47At8yM7wSMrEWge6eEo
transaction
5670224cfa14b554a2428a3880b21e49fe3452935a0aa4611dbb03de00026c88
spent
true